The KAPSARC project summary is as follows: 1) KAPSARC is an 887,000 sq ft research and policy center in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ia designed by Zaha Hadid and completed in 2012 for $543 million. 2) The complex connects three main buildings - a research center, library, and conference center - with access tunnels and utilizes sustainable design. 3) Drake & Scull Construction undertook civil works, architecture, interiors, MEP works, and landscaping for the project, which had complicated geometry and detailed specifications.

Project Case Study

KAPSARC
Project: King Abdullah
Petroleum Studies and
Research Centre
Start Date: 2011
Completion Date: 2012
Location: Riyadh, KSA
Industry: Education
Developer: Saudi ARAMCO
Consultant/Architect: Zaha Hadid
Value: US $ 543 Million
